What are video game writers?

Video game writers are professionals responsible for creating the narrative elements of video games, including dialogue, storylines, character development, and world-building. They collaborate closely with designers, developers, and artists to ensure the story integrates seamlessly with gameplay and visuals. Video game writers may also write in-game text, quests, lore, and contribute to the overall tone and emotional impact of the game. Their role is essential in making games immersive and engaging for players.

What are some common challenges faced by video game writers during the development process?

Video game writers often face challenges such as adapting narrative elements to evolving gameplay mechanics and collaborating with designers to ensure story and gameplay are seamlessly integrated. The iterative nature of game development may require frequent revisions to dialogue and storylines, sometimes on tight deadlines. Additionally, writers must balance creative storytelling with technical constraints, such as limited text space or branching dialogue, to create engaging narratives that enhance the player’s experience.

What is the difference between Video Game Writer vs Narrative Designer?

AspectVideo Game WriterNarrative Designer
CredentialsWriting degrees, storytelling experienceWriting, storytelling, game design background
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with designers, developers, and writersWorks closely with designers, programmers, and writers
Industry UsageCommonly employed in game studios for story developmentFocuses on narrative structure and gameplay integration

While both roles involve storytelling, a Video Game Writer primarily creates dialogue, scripts, and storylines, whereas a Narrative Designer develops the overall narrative structure, integrating story with gameplay mechanics. The roles often overlap but differ in scope and focus within the game development process.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Video Game Writer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Video Game Writer, you need strong storytelling abilities, scriptwriting experience, and a deep understanding of narrative design, often supported by a degree in creative writing, English, or a related field. Familiarity with industry-standard tools like Twine, Ink, Final Draft, and collaborative platforms such as Jira or Confluence is common. Creativity, collaboration, adaptability, and effective communication are vital soft skills for working with multidisciplinary teams and responding to feedback. These skills and qualities ensure engaging, coherent game narratives that enhance player immersion and support a game's overall vision.

What Does a Video Game Writer Do?

A video game writer works to develop the plot and write the dialogue for a video game. In this career, your responsibilities may include working to design the story for a video game during pre-production. Your duties may include working to create characters and describe the game narrative. The video game designers and programmers may rely on your script and storyline to give the game structure. As a video game writer, you may work with a video game designer who is responsible for all aspects of the video game.
